Chapter 264 Felicia Looked For Her

Mrs. Godfrey's angry voice echoed in the room, ringing loud in everyone's ears.

Everleigh stood up to her, her eyes cold as ice.

"Mrs. Godfrey, you have used such a way to destroy my reputation. Are you not also ignoring my existence?"

"Whatever I did does not justify whatever you've done. You've caused Helen's death; how dare you stand here and talk to me in this manner?" Mrs. Godfrey hated the sight of Everleigh.

It was all this woman's fault that her son treated her like an enemy.

"Mrs. Godfrey, statements should be backed up with evidence. You are saying that she killed Madam Helen, but there is nothing to support your statement." Dr. Harrison also stood up and protected Everleigh behind him. He wouldn't want anything to happen to her.

She felt touched at the sight of Dr. Harrison standing up for her.

"Tell me then, how did my mother-in-law die without any reason?"

"A heart transplant surgery always has its own risks. Your son was well aware of this fact, but he still signed his consent nevertheless. No one wanted to see Madam Helen's parting, but you should not blame others for this," Stainley said firmly as he stood up.

No matter what, they knew that they were on the right side.

Everleigh would certainly not be punished for this, just based on mere words.

Mrs. Godfrey saw that they were all angry with her, so she stretched out her fingers and pointed at them, her hands trembling.

"Well, aren't you all on the same side. Trying to bring me down, are you? Well, I'll show you what I'm made of." Mrs. Godfrey was burning with anger as she turned around and left.

Mr. Lawson looked at her retreating figure worriedly. He couldn't possibly guess what she would do after this.

Sure enough, it didn't take long for Mrs. Godfrey to stop the hospital's resources and funds, making Mr. Lawson even more busy. There were too many shenanigans like this, so it was meaningless for him to drive Everleigh out of the hospital at this point.
